## Decision 5 — Use a bounded readiness contract with explicit limitation flags instead of pass/fail or certification language
|
|
|
|
**Decision**: Keep the customer-safe interpretation contract bounded to a small readiness vocabulary plus explicit limitation flags. The planned primary readiness buckets are:
|
|
|
|
- `follow_up_required`
|
|
- `review_recommended`
|
|
- `evidence_on_record`
|
|
|
|
The planned limitation flags are:
|
|
|
|
- `accepted_risk_influenced`
|
|
- `partial_mapping`
|
|
- `stale_evidence`
|
|
- `supporting_evidence_unavailable`
|
|
- `unmapped`
|
|
|
|
**Rationale**:
|
|
- The feature must help a customer decide what needs follow-up without implying formal certification or legal compliance.
|
|
- A small readiness vocabulary with explicit limitation modifiers is easier to localize, easier to test, and less likely to overstate the evidence basis than a large scoring system.
|
|
- Keeping accepted risk as a modifier preserves the distinction between a governed exception and a fully positive readiness claim.
|
|
|
|
**Alternatives considered**:
|
|
- Use compliant / non-compliant / certified language.
|
|
- Rejected: overstates what the product can legitimately claim.
|
|
- Add a larger scorecard or framework-specific status ladder.
|
|
- Rejected: imports framework-engine complexity that the spec explicitly defers.
